2016-04-28 11 views
1

しようとコードのこの作品は、学習MySQLとMariaDB本からです:のMySQL:、rootのパスワードを設定するSQL構文でエラーが発生しました

mysql -u root -p -e "SET PASSWORD FOR 'root'@'127.0.0.1' PASSWORD('new_pwd');" 

そして、私はこのエラーを取得しています:

ERROR 1064 (42000) at line 1: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for th 
e right syntax to use near 'PASSWORD('new_pwd')' at line 1 

この本は正しいですか?この構文は古いですか?どうしたの?

答えて

2

で試してみてください。

mysql -u root -p -e "SET PASSWORD FOR 'root'@'127.0.0.1' = PASSWORD('new_pwd');" 
+1

ありがとう!今はうまくいく。 – 9Algorithm

+0

クール。私はそれがうまくいってうれしいです。また、解決策として私の答えを受け入れてください:) –

関連する問題